Topic: fossil skull
-
Million-Year-Old Skull Mystery: Is It a Denisovan?
The Yunxian 2 skull, discovered in China and dated between 600,000 and one million years old, has been digitally reconstructed, revealing features that align more closely with Denisovans or *Homo longi* rather than its initial *Homo erectus* classification. Its reconstruction shows remarkable sim...
Read More »